Transaction 7563955ccf8fb1ffffd11aee46b3dc48ec0763426201c77523dd5473559e2e42

2 Input
2 Outputs
  • 7563955ccf8fb1ffffd11aee46b3dc48ec0763426201c77523dd5473559e2e42:0
  • value  2279000
    address  159pY7izHLWQtCiEM5YziKz7hsvPU2qrew
  • 7563955ccf8fb1ffffd11aee46b3dc48ec0763426201c77523dd5473559e2e42:1
  • value  612269
    address  34nDFXNYPp1cSU83RSBUK39kRaLBbTrFWw